What is a teraflop in GHz?
OK, what is a TFLOP? Unlike gigahertz (GHz), which measures a processor’s clock speed, TFLOP is a direct mathematical measurement of a computer’s performance. Specifically, a teraflop refers to a processor’s capability to calculate one trillion floating-point operations per second.
How fast is a GigaFlop?
GigaFLOPS. A 1 gigaFLOPS (GFLOPS) computer system is capable of performing one billion (109) floating-point operations per second. To match what a 1 GFLOPS computer system can do in just one second, you’d have to perform one calculation every second for 31.69 years.

How many teraFLOPS are in a supercomputer?
Teraflops in the world’s supercomputers have improved dramatically over the years. To put it in perspective: one of the earliest supercomputers, the CDC Star-100, was the most advanced supercomputer of its day in 1974, coming in at 100 megaflops.
How many teraflops is the human brain?
How Many Teraflops Is the Human Brain? Hans Moravec, the principal research scientist at the Robotics Institute of Carnegie Mellon University, calculated that the human brain’s processing power probably stands around 100 teraflops.
